Meminimalkan Downtime Aplikasi dengan Menggunakan SLO dalam Pembangunan


Pendahuluan:

Dalam dunia yang semakin terhubung dan canggih, aplikasi mobile telah menjadi tulang punggung aktivitas sehari-hari. Oleh karena itu, penting bagi pengembang untuk memastikan ketersediaan dan kinerja optimal dari aplikasi mereka. Salah satu cara efektif untuk mencapai hal ini adalah dengan mengimplementasikan Service Level Objectives (SLO) dalam proses pembangunan aplikasi mobile. Artikel ini akan menjelaskan pentingnya SLO dalam meminimalkan downtime aplikasi dan memberikan panduan praktis untuk mengatasi keterbatasan perangkat.


Pentingnya SLO dalam Meminimalkan Downtime Aplikasi:

1. Meningkatkan Kualitas Layanan: Dengan mengukur dan memantau kinerja aplikasi melalui SLO, pengembang dapat secara proaktif mengidentifikasi masalah sebelum mereka menjadi downtime yang signifikan. Hal ini mengarah pada peningkatan kualitas layanan yang dirasakan oleh pengguna.

2. Pengukuran Objektif: SLO menyediakan metrik yang objektif untuk mengukur kinerja aplikasi. Ini membantu tim pengembang memiliki pandangan yang jelas tentang apakah aplikasi memenuhi harapan kinerja yang ditetapkan.

3. Perencanaan Kapasitas yang Lebih Baik: Dengan memahami SLO, pengembang dapat merencanakan kapasitas server dan sumber daya dengan lebih baik, menghindari lonjakan lalu lintas yang dapat menyebabkan downtime tak terduga.


Menghadapi Keterbatasan Perangkat:

1. Optimisasi Kinerja: Pertimbangkan untuk mengoptimalkan performa aplikasi dengan mengurangi waktu respon dan meminimalkan penggunaan sumber daya. Gunakan teknik caching, kompresi data, dan penggunaan memori yang efisien.

2. Adaptasi Resolusi dan Tampilan: Untuk mengatasi perangkat dengan layar berbeda, pertimbangkan desain responsif atau bahkan menyediakan versi tampilan yang disesuaikan dengan resolusi yang lebih rendah.

3. Manajemen Memori: Aplikasi harus memiliki manajemen memori yang baik agar tidak mengalami crash atau kinerja lambat pada perangkat dengan kapasitas memori terbatas.

4. Optimisasi Jaringan: Aplikasi harus mampu berfungsi secara lancar di koneksi jaringan yang bervariasi, termasuk koneksi yang lemah. Pertimbangkan teknik seperti pengaturan timeout yang bijaksana dan manajemen penggunaan data.


Kesimpulan:

Menerapkan SLO dalam pembangunan aplikasi mobile adalah langkah kritis untuk meminimalkan downtime yang dapat merugikan pengalaman pengguna dan reputasi aplikasi. Dengan memahami keterbatasan perangkat dan mengambil langkah-langkah proaktif untuk mengatasinya, pengembang dapat menghadirkan aplikasi yang responsif, andal, dan tetap berkinerja optimal di berbagai lingkungan perangkat. Dengan demikian, SLO menjadi alat penting dalam menjaga ketersediaan dan kualitas layanan aplikasi mobile.

Baca Juga:

Baca Juga:

Jumlah Biaya Pengurusan Sertifikat Laik Fungsi (SLF)

9 SOAL SLF YANG WAJIB DIKETAHUI

Apa tujuan dan manfaat perpanjangan SLF?

Manajemen Konstruksi, Seberapa Penting Untuk Bangunan Anda?

Manajemen Konstruksi Menurut Para Ahli

Baca juga: 

Mengintegrasikan Teknologi Cerdas: Arsitektur Dalam Era Digital

Bangunan Futuristik: Menggali Batas-batas Kreativitas dalam Desain Arsitektur

Menghidupkan Ruang: Peran Seni dalam Desain Arsitektur Kontemporer

Keandalan Struktural: Proses Jasa Audit Struktur yang Teliti

Jasa Audit Struktur: Meningkatkan Ketahanan Bangunan terhadap Gempa Bumi

Komentar

Postingan populer dari blog ini

Memahami Fungsi dan Keunggulan Wheel Loader dalam Konstruksi

Strategi Bertanam Pohon: Membangun Bayangan Alami di Halaman Rumah

Peralatan Pemotong Beton: Meningkatkan Presisi dalam Proyek Konstruksi